School Police (2021) emerges as a poignant and vital contribution to the youth drama genre, particularly in its unflinching exploration of school violence and the systemic indifference that often accompanies it. Diverging significantly from conventional coming-of-age narratives that merely skim the surface, this production delves into the intricate psychological landscapes of both victims and perpetrators, juxtaposed against a disheartening lack of institutional justice. The directorial vision, though uncredited, effectively employs haunting close-ups and fragmented editing to cultivate a pervasive sense of tension, mirroring the suffocating and oppressive atmosphere within the educational setting. While the ensemble's performances occasionally exhibit unevenness, the raw authenticity in their emotional responses largely compensates, especially during climactic sequences that underscore profound internal conflicts and deep-seated trauma. The film transcends a mere cautionary tale, evolving into a critical social commentary on collective responsibility and the pivotal role of educational institutions, securing its place within the cinematic landscape as a work with significant ethical resonance. It stands as a powerful piece that refuses to sanitize harsh realities, enriching the discourse on socially conscious filmmaking and psychological dramas.
